Manchester barely beat Fayetteville-Perry the last time the pair played, but that sure wasn't the case this time around. The Greyhounds were the clear victors by a 14-5 margin over the Rockets on Thursday. The result was nothing new for the Greyhounds, who have now won four games by six runs or more so far this season.
The team relied heavily on Luke Applegate, who went 2-for-4 with three runs, four RBI, and two doubles. That's the most runs he has posted since back in April of 2024. Braylon Rickett was another key player, getting on base in all four of his plate appearances with two runs and one stolen base.
Manchester was getting hits left and right and finished the game having posted a batting average of .407. That was just more of the same: they've now posted a batting average of .407 or higher in three consecutive matches.
Manchester's victory was their fourth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 5-2. The home wins came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 11.8 runs over those games. As for Fayetteville-Perry, they have been struggling recently as they've lost four of their last five cont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 2-7 record this season.
Manchester will venture away from home to square off against Minford at 6:30 p.m. on Friday. As for Fayetteville-Perry, they will host Fairfield at 5:00 p.m. on Friday.
